Text::PDF::String(3)  User Contributed Perl Documentation Text::PDF::String(3)

NAME
       Text::PDF::String - PDF String type objects and superclass for simple
       objects that are basically stringlike (Number, Name, etc.)

METHODS
   Text::PDF::String->from_pdf($string)
       Creates a new string object (not a full object yet) from a given
       string.	The string is parsed according to input criteria with escaping
       working.

   Text::PDF::String->new($string)
       Creates a new string object (not a full object yet) from a given
       string.	The string is parsed according to input criteria with escaping
       working.

   $s->convert($str)
       Returns $str converted as per criteria for input from PDF file

   $s->val
       Returns the value of this string (the string itself).

   $->as_pdf
       Returns the string formatted for output as PDF for PDF File object
       $pdf.

   $s->outobjdeep
       Outputs the string in PDF format, complete with necessary conversions

   $s->copy($inpdf, $res, $unique, $outpdf, %opts)
       Copies an object. See Text::PDF::Objind::Copy() for details
